The Impact of Rugs on Room Definition

Rugs are more than just floor coverings; they serve as anchors for furniture arrangements and define distinct zones within open-plan living areas. A carefully chosen rug can subtly guide the eye, create a sense of cohesion, and introduce color and pattern to a room. When selecting a rug, consider the size of the space and the layout of your furniture. A rug that is too small can make a room feel disjointed, while a rug that is too large can overwhelm the space. Placement is also important – ideally, the front legs of your furniture should rest on the rug, creating a unified and balanced look. Different rug materials evoke different feelings; a thick shag rug adds warmth and coziness, while a flatweave rug provides a more streamlined and modern aesthetic. Don't be afraid to experiment with different textures, patterns, and colors to find a rug that perfectly complements your existing décor.

Rug Material Best Suited For Maintenance Level
Wool High-traffic areas, living rooms, bedrooms Moderate – Requires professional cleaning
Synthetic (Polypropylene) Outdoor areas, kitchens, kids' rooms Easy – Can be cleaned with soap and water
Cotton Casual spaces, bedrooms, bathrooms Moderate – Machine washable
Silk Formal living rooms, low-traffic areas High – Requires professional cleaning and gentle care

Understanding the optimal rug size and material for a specific room is integral to maximizing its design potential. A well-chosen rug acts as the foundation for a cohesive and inviting space.

The Art of Lighting: Setting the Mood

Lighting is arguably one of the most impactful elements of interior design. It’s not simply about illuminating a space; it’s about creating atmosphere, highlighting focal points, and influencing mood. A well-lit room feels more inviting, spacious, and comfortable. There are three main types of lighting to consider: ambient, task, and accent. Ambient lighting provides overall illumination, task lighting focuses light on specific areas for activities like reading or cooking, and accent lighting highlights artwork or architectural features. Layering these different types of lighting allows you to create a dynamic and versatile lighting scheme. Dimmer switches are invaluable for controlling the intensity of light and tailoring the ambiance to suit different occasions. Consider the color temperature of your light bulbs as well; warmer tones create a cozy and relaxing atmosphere, while cooler tones are more energizing and conducive to focus. The lighting choices should complement the overall style of the room and enhance its aesthetic appeal.

The Role of Lamps in Creating Cozy Nooks

Lamps are particularly effective for creating cozy and intimate nooks within a larger room. A strategically placed table lamp or floor lamp can transform a corner into a comfortable reading spot or a relaxing area for conversation. The shade of the lamp plays a significant role in the quality of light; a soft, diffused shade will create a warmer and more inviting glow, while a more translucent shade will allow for brighter, more focused light. Experiment with different lamp styles and shades to find combinations that complement your décor and create the desired ambiance. Don't underestimate the power of a well-chosen lampshade to elevate the overall aesthetic of a room. Lamps offer a convenient and stylish way to add layers of light and enhance the functionality of any space.

Creating a Gallery Wall: A Step-by-Step Guide

A gallery wall is a visually striking way to showcase a collection of artwork, photographs, and other decorative items. Before you begin, plan the layout on the floor to ensure a balanced and cohesive composition. Mix and match different frame styles, sizes, and orientations to create visual interest, but maintain a consistent color palette or theme to tie everything together. Start with a larger piece as the focal point and then arrange the smaller pieces around it. Leave consistent spacing between the frames for a clean and polished look. Use a level to ensure that all the frames are hung straight. Don't be afraid to experiment with different arrangements until you find one that you love.
